The Samsung Galaxy S24 is a highly anticipated flagship device, and choosing the right case can enhance its usability and protection. Two popular options are tactile cases and smooth cases. Each offers distinct advantages and disadvantages that cater to different user preferences.

What Are Tactile Cases?

Tactile cases are designed to provide a textured, often rubberized or ridged surface that enhances grip. They typically feature raised patterns or bumps to give users a physical feel when holding the device. This design aims to prevent slips and accidental drops, making them ideal for users who prioritize grip and tactile feedback.

Features of Tactile Cases

  • Enhanced grip with textured surface
  • Often made of rubber or silicone
  • Provides a secure hold, reducing slips
  • May add bulk to the device
  • Usually offers good shock absorption

Advantages of Tactile Cases

  • Better grip reduces the risk of dropping
  • Physical feedback can improve handling
  • Often more durable and protective
  • Less likely to slide off surfaces

What Are Smooth Cases?

Smooth cases are characterized by their sleek, polished surface, often made of hard plastic or polycarbonate. They emphasize a clean aesthetic and a slim profile, providing a minimalist look. These cases offer a different tactile experience, focusing on elegance and simplicity.

Features of Smooth Cases

  • Polished, glossy, or matte surface
  • Usually slim and lightweight
  • Minimalistic design
  • Easy to slide in and out of pockets
  • Provides basic protection against scratches

Advantages of Smooth Cases

  • Elegant appearance enhances device aesthetics
  • Lightweight and unobtrusive
  • Easy to clean and maintain
  • Allows the device’s original design to show through

Comparison Summary

Choosing between tactile and smooth cases depends on user preferences and priorities. Tactile cases excel in grip and protection, making them suitable for users who handle their device frequently or in active environments. Smooth cases appeal to those who prefer a sleek look and minimal bulk, emphasizing style over tactile feedback.
